summaryrefslogtreecommitdiff
path: root/reference/C/CONTRIB/OR_USING_C/07.1.c
diff options
context:
space:
mode:
authorTobias Klauser <tklauser@distanz.ch>2008-01-27 11:37:44 +0100
committerTobias Klauser <tklauser@xenon.tklauser.home>2008-01-27 11:37:44 +0100
commit7e0f021a9aec35fd8e6725e87e3313b101d26f5e (patch)
treeb1cacc4b24393f517aeb4610e9e1021f954307a8 /reference/C/CONTRIB/OR_USING_C/07.1.c
Initial import (2.0.2-6)2.0.2-6
Diffstat (limited to 'reference/C/CONTRIB/OR_USING_C/07.1.c')
-rw-r--r--reference/C/CONTRIB/OR_USING_C/07.1.c21
1 files changed, 21 insertions, 0 deletions
diff --git a/reference/C/CONTRIB/OR_USING_C/07.1.c b/reference/C/CONTRIB/OR_USING_C/07.1.c
new file mode 100644
index 0000000..19ae68e
--- /dev/null
+++ b/reference/C/CONTRIB/OR_USING_C/07.1.c
@@ -0,0 +1,21 @@
+#include <sys/types.h>
+#include <sys/times.h>
+
+main()
+{
+ struct tms before, after;
+
+ times(&before);
+
+ /* ... place code to be timed here ... */
+
+ times(&after);
+
+ printf("User time: %ld seconds\n", after.tms_utime -
+ before.tms_utime);
+ printf("System time: %ld seconds\n", after.tms_stime -
+ before.tms_stime);
+
+ exit(0);
+}
+